Description

As the Manager of Commercial Applied AI Architects at Anthropic, you will drive adoption of frontier AI across mid-market and SMB customers by leading a team of technical architects who help companies build and deploy with the Claude API, Claude Code, the Agent SDK, and Claude for Enterprise.

Responsibilities:

  • Manage, coach, and grow a team of Commercial Applied AI Architects, setting a high bar for technical credibility, customer impact, and speed
  • Own hiring for your team as it scales, defining the profile, running the loop, and building onboarding that gets new architects into customer conversations quickly
  • Set goals and run reviews for your team, and develop each architect's career with clear, direct feedback
  • Decide where your team's depth goes. Own the qualification and prioritization framework for Applied AI engagement across a very large book, and be comfortable saying no
  • Work alongside your architects on their most consequential engagements, from technical discovery through deployment and expansion, and model what great looks like without taking the work off their plate
  • Build and own the segment's technical playbooks for Claude API integrations, Claude Code rollouts, agentic architectures on the Agent SDK, and Claude for Enterprise deployments, and turn account-level wins into reusable assets that scale one-to-many
  • Partner closely with Commercial sales leadership and Account Executives to co-build segment strategy, tighten the AE-to-architect operating model, and drive adoption across mid-market and SMB
  • Ensure your team consistently surfaces how mid-market companies are building with Claude, and translate that signal into actionable feedback for Product and Engineering
  • Represent Anthropic technically at customer sites, workshops, roadshows, and events, and contribute to thought leadership through content and speaking
  • Stay ahead of the AI engineering landscape, including agentic architectures, eval design, context engineering, and developer tooling, and keep your team operating at the frontier

Requirements:

  • Have 7+ years of experience in technical customer-facing roles (Solutions Architect, Sales Engineer, Forward Deployed Engineer, or similar), with 3+ years managing pre-sales or technical go-to-market teams
  • Know how to hire well, coach effectively, give hard feedback kindly, and create an environment where builders do their best work
  • Have led technical teams in a high-velocity, high-volume sales motion, where the constraint is your team's capacity rather than pipeline, and have a real point of view on how to allocate scarce technical talent across a large book
  • Bring builder credibility. You have built and deployed LLM-powered applications, you understand what separates a prototype from a production system, and you can hold your own with a customer's engineering leadership
  • Have hands-on familiarity with agentic architectures, LLM evaluation, and modern AI developer tooling, and can coach architects through the design decisions their customers face
  • Have a systems mindset. When you see a problem, your instinct is to build one thing that serves ten customers rather than ten things that serve one
  • Are comfortable in ambiguous, early-stage environments where the playbook does not exist yet, and have a track record of building structure as you go
  • Have strong executive presence and can build trust with technical and business leaders alike
  • Have a genuine passion for making powerful technology safe and societally beneficial
